Description

This Colder panel mount coupler is a robust, quick-connect fitting designed for efficient and reliable fluid/air distribution in equipment panels. Ideal for installations where clean and accessible connections are required, this coupler blends durable materials with precision engineering to deliver dependable performance in demanding applications.

 

Key Features & Specifications

Feature

Description

Material

High-grade acetal (plastic) offering excellent strength, chemical resistance, and dimensional stability

Type / Shape

Panel mount coupler (bracketed for installation on panels)

Connection Style

Barbed fitting on both sides for hose/tubing; quick-connect coupling style

Size

3⁄8″ inner diameter tubing / pipe fitting

Overall Dimensions

Body diameter ~1.01 in, length ~1.95 in (1 15⁄16 in)

Operating Temperature Range

–40 °F to 180 °F (≈ –40 °C to 82 °C)

Maximum Pressure

120 psi (≈ 8.3 bar)

Flow Control

Integrated shut-off valve — allows disconnect under pressure without fluid loss

Standards / Certifications

FDA, NSF, RoHS, USDA compliant

Color

White

Intended Media

Suitable for air and non-potable water applications

Country of Origin

United States

 

Benefits & Applications

  • Panel-mounted design ensures clean, accessible connections through panels or enclosures, reducing clutter behind control boards or mounting surfaces.
  • Shut-off feature lets you disconnect lines without draining or depressurizing the entire system, saving time and reducing leaks during maintenance.
  • Acetal construction balances strength, chemical resistance, and low weight—ideal for industrial, pneumatic, or fluid systems.
  • Wide temperature tolerance supports use in cold environments (–40 °F) up to moderate heat conditions (180 °F).
  • Reliable pressure rating (120 psi) covers a broad range of typical industrial and lab pneumatic/fluid systems.
  • Certifications (FDA, NSF, etc.) make it suitable where regulatory compliance is needed (though only for non-potable fluids as specified).

 

Suggested Use Cases

  • Pneumatic control systems in manufacturing or automation panels
  • Instrumentation enclosures where modular tubing connections are needed
  • Laboratory or process setups requiring frequent line changes
  • Applications needing reliable quick-disconnects with shut-off capability
